Thera-Band Resistive Exercise Tubing – 25 Ft. Green is a trusted, professional-grade tool designed to support hand rehabilitation and therapeutic exercise. The 25-foot patient roll provides ample material for a wide range of grip, finger, and wrist exercises, enabling therapists and patients to perform controlled resistance routines in clinical and home settings. The tubing is made from natural rubber, delivering durable elasticity that withstands repeated use while maintaining consistent resistance across sessions. The color-coded system signals resistance level, with seven levels of difficulty spanning from tan to silver; this product represents the medium green color within that spectrum, offering a mid-range resistance as strength and dexterity improve.
